Thanks. Thought I broke 5th gear last time out ( dragmania Ennis ) but it ended up being a loose shifter rod bracket on the trans. installing a larger flow control valve jet and hope to get better 60ft times. Also replacing the blown front struts before the next test. next week.

Qualifying pass VS Honda. What a mess with the staging lights. Ended up with a charlie horse in my calf from holding the clutch down for so long.
119 mph in the 1/8
2.35 60 ft
10.3 at 149
Outside video by GRS. It's about 40% down on the list. It was the Honda's PB.

Ran rich in 4th gear causing miss fire. Lost some et and MPH. Cool weather last night and ran a bit more boost in 4th gear.
Really need to upgrade the rear shocks. Guys are saying it looks like a bunny rabbit in first and second gear.
